What's The Definition Of Papyrograph?Synonyms | Synonyms for Papyrograph: Related Terms | Find terms related to Papyrograph: See Also | Papyrograph In Webster's Dictionary \Pa*pyr"o*graph\, n. [Papyrus + -graph.]
An apparatus for multiplying writings, drawings, etc., in
which a paper stencil, formed by writing or drawing with
corrosive ink, is used. The word is also used of other means
of multiplying copies of writings, drawings, etc. See
{Copygraph}, {Hectograph}, {Manifold}.
